I'm a total newbie when it comes to tractors. We have a B&B surrounded by about 20 acres of grass fields with about 3500 ft of driveway and parking lot.
I already have a mower, which is not a tractor, for the grass around the house, but it's not appropriate for cutting the grass in the fields.
I was going to get a used pickup with a plow for the snow on the driveway and a small used tractor to clear the grass in the fields.
I was wondering if I could get both plowing and field mowing done less expensively with just a used tractor. That way I could kill two birds with one stone.
It typically snows less than a foot in our region. We have about 3500 ft. of paved driveway to plow.
There are about 20 acres of grass fields to cut. There aren't any hills.

Add a rear blade and 4wd (or chains) to the tractor cost. And then deal with being out in the cold and wind when doing the snow removal.

I'd vote for a plow truck if it were mine. Trucks can be used for a ton of other things too, if you dont already have a truck.

Do you really need a cab? I expect yhat would add a lot to the price of a used tractor. You might look in Craigslist for used tractors in your area. While snowplowing can be done with a 2wd tractor with rear chains, you probably want 4wd if you are going to use it for plowing. Chains are around $300 and a used rear blade plow can be had for $200ish . You need to be aware of the differences between a rear finish mower and a brush hogging and decide which you need for your field.

A 4wd plow truck will be warmer and faster and you probably have plenty to do with your time. But mind you things breakdown at the most inopportune time.

Forgive my ignorance of tractors - Will a Kubota B7400 be able to mow 20 acres in a reasonable amount of time?

What is a "reasonable amount of time" to you?

Give us the time you can stand mowing when the thermometer is over 94 degrees.

A B7400 can pull a 48" Rotary Cutter, so you can cut a 42" swath with 6" overlap.
